    I bought my 1967 Moke in Glasgow in 1967. Drove it there for a year, shipped it the States and drove across the Sates from New York to Los Angeles and used it there for six months. Shipped it to Ghana and used it there for two years before selling it for more than I paid for it. Wold love to have another one but will have to make do with the current Smart car.
